KIG Brokers $86 Million Portfolio Sale In Downtown Chicago

Once the focus of local investors, loft office buildings in downtown neighborhoods like River North and the West Loop are now attracting institutional capital, as evidenced by a recent $86 million portfolio sale brokered by Taylor Johnson client KIG CRE. Real estate investment firm R2 Companies and Walton Street Capital purchased the properties from Chicago-based Loft Development Corp., which was represented by KIG Principal and Managing Broker Susan Tjarksen. As Crain’s Chicago Business reports, the portfolio includes six loft office buildings comprising a total of 449,000 square feet and three parking lots the new owners plan to redevelop as residential and office.
